Matt Drudge Issues Rare Tweets to Mark President Trump Hitting 50% Approval In Rasmussen Poll
The Hill ^ | 06/16/17 09:53 AM EDT | By Joe Concha -

Posted on 06/16/2017 8:47:38 AM PDT by drewh

Drudge Report founder Matt Drudge posted a rare tweet on Friday touting President Trump hitting 50 percent in a daily tracking poll by Rasmussen Reports.

"Sound of the atom splitting... coming from Rasmussen, most accurate poll of '16," Drudge wrote to his followers.

Drudge citing Rasmussen being the "most accurate of 2016" is in reference to the 2016 election, when the polling firm says it was the closest of all major pollsters in predicting the presidential election’s popular vote, pointing to final results posted by RealClearPolitics.

On its final poll released Nov. 7, the day before Election Day, Rasmussen had Hillary Clinton

up 2 points on Donald Trump

. Clinton won the popular vote by 1 percentage point, even though Donald Trump beat her on electoral votes.

No other pollster tracked by RealClearPolitics came as close to the final results.

Rasmussen has been a consistent outlier since Trump took office, however, with the president sitting at 39.9 percent when averaging all major approval polls, including Rasmussen. The 39.9 percent does not include Rasmussen jumping from 47 percent on Thursday to 50 percent Friday.

Drudge has been relatively more active on Twitter since Trump's inauguration on Jan. 20, primarily deriding Republicans on Capitol Hill for its slow pace implementing GOP legislative issues.

The 51-year-old Drudge always deletes his tweets a few hours after posting them. He doesn't follow any accounts on Twitter.
